VirtualSampleControl-class: Class "VirtualSampleControl"

Description Objects from the Class Slots Extends Accessor and mutator methods Methods UML class diagram Author(s) References See Also Examples

Description

Virtual superclass for controlling the setup of samples.

Objects from the Class

A virtual Class: No objects may be created from it.

Slots

k:

Object of class "numeric", a single positive integer giving the number of samples to be set up.

Extends

Class "OptSampleControl", directly.

Accessor and mutator methods

getK

signature(x = "VirtualSampleControl"): get slot k.

setK

signature(x = "VirtualSampleControl"): set slot k.

Methods

clusterRunSimulation

signature(cl = "ANY", x = "data.frame", setup = "VirtualSampleControl", nrep = "missing", control = "SimControl"): run a simulation experiment on a cluster.

clusterRunSimulation

signature(cl = "ANY", x = "VirtualDataControl", setup = "VirtualSampleControl", nrep = "numeric", control = "SimControl"): run a simulation experiment on a cluster.

draw

signature(x = "data.frame", setup = "VirtualSampleControl"): draw a sample.

head

signature(x = "VirtualSampleControl"): currently returns the object itself.

length

signature(x = "VirtualSampleControl"): get the number of samples to be set up.

runSimulation

signature(x = "data.frame", setup = "VirtualSampleControl", nrep = "missing", control = "SimControl"): run a simulation experiment.

runSimulation

signature(x = "VirtualDataControl", setup = "VirtualSampleControl", nrep = "numeric", control = "SimControl"): run a simulation experiment.

runSimulation

signature(x = "VirtualDataControl", setup = "VirtualSampleControl", nrep = "missing", control = "SimControl"): run a simulation experiment.

show

signature(object = "VirtualSampleControl"): print the object on the R console.

summary

signature(object = "VirtualSampleControl"): currently returns the object itself.

tail

signature(x = "VirtualSampleControl"): currently returns the object itself.
